The process to get ASD dx. Can anyone explain ,please?

4 replies

mysonben · 28/05/2009 23:56

Who make the reports and how many are needed? Who makes the dx? What about evaluations using the ADI-R or ADOS ,are these always used? or can dx reached with only observations and reports? I'm all confused. Please help, thanks.

afraid the exact procedure and no. of professionals involved and no. of appointments varies from area to area, so you would have to phone up your local early years service or child development centre (i.e. whoever deals with the referrals) to find out more.

Both Ds1 and Ds2 (DS1 definite diagnosis, Ds2 strongly suspected) have been referred first by a GP, then seen a paediatrician, then have had (or are due to have) a multidisciplinary assessment, where they were.will be checked by SALT, ed psych, OT, nursery nurse plus some others (can never remember whether one is a psychologist or a psychiatrist.
Ds2 also had a 3DI test (well, I did it for him), which is a detailed series of questions

What Total says - it completely depends on the area. We got referred by HV, got seen by SALT, got seen by MDA (two paeds and a SALT) who made the dx on the basis of observation of DS and long questionnaire (no idea which questionnaire it was though). Have been referred to Ed Psych, no referral to OT because no major sensory issues identified

Every area seems to be different.

Ds1 was given a SALT referral by the HV. The SALT suspected autism (although she wasn't allowed to tell me that at the time) and made a referral to see the Paed. The Paed also thought it was autism and so ds1 was given a multi-disciplinary assessment where he saw the OT, Physio, Child Psych, and another SALT. At the end of the assessment was a big meeting where everyone gave their findings and the Paed then gave the diagnosis. No specific tests were given.

Ds2 was referred straight to the Paed by the Early Years team. Then like his brother he was referred for a multi-disciplinary assessment with the same procedures.
